Q: Is 77,415 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 77,415 is a composite number.

Why is 77,415 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 77,415 can be evenly divided by 1 3 5 13 15 39 65 195 397 1,191 1,985 5,161 5,955 15,483 25,805 and 77,415, with no remainder.

Since 77,415 cannot be divided by just 1 and 77,415, it is a composite number.
